Practical Implementation Checklist for System Architects



  1. Systems Discovery and Inventory: Conduct a thorough inventory of legacy databases, active API endpoints, and network connections to identify potential security vulnerabilities.

  2. Defining Governance Protocols: Establishing governance policies early prevents unauthorized access and ensures full audit readiness.

  3. Iterative Staging and Validation: Run controlled pilot trials using automated transmission workflows to test server loads and measure bandwidth consumption.

  4. Production Deployment and Live Cutover: Execute final cutover scripts during low-traffic windows while enforcing continuous system monitoring to verify system performance.

  5. Continuous Auditing and Log Analysis: Utilize automated log monitoring tools to track transmission speeds, detect anomaly patterns, and maintain comprehensive audit trails.
